I seem to be getting an FPS drop, I'm not too sure what is causing it.
I use HWMonitor & Corsair Link to check my temps and have re-seated my CPU cooler and my GPU never gets too hot.
This happens in every game, regardless of launcher.
This is significant 45-70fps drops depending on the title.
It only happens when my account has been logged into for around half an hour, and will just do it without warning regardless of single player or multiplayer.
Logging out and back in will resolve the issue for another half hour.
However, I spent all of yesterday playing a game and nothing, but then the next day with no new updates installed I'm not able to play anything for a prolonged period of time.
I performed scans, I monitor my temperatures, my SSD still has 250GB of spare storage.
Specs:
i7 4770k
Asus Strix GTX970
Sandisk 960GB Ultra II Performance SSD
Windows 10 (latest version as of post).
